How do I set up a Comcast Business Router
If you have a Comcast Business Router, you can easily set it up by following these simple steps:
1. Connect the power cord to the router and plug it into an outlet.
2. Connect the Ethernet cable from the modem to the “Internet” port on the router.
3. Connect the Ethernet cable from your computer to the “LAN” port on the router.
4. Open a web browser and type in “10.0.0.1” into the address bar. This will take you to the router’s web-based setup page.
5. Enter your username and password. The default username is “admin” and the default password is “password”.
6. Once you’re logged in, click on the “Wireless” tab and then click on the “Basic Settings” sub-tab.
7. Enter a name for your wireless network under the “Wireless Network Name (SSID)” field and then choose a password for your network under the “Wireless Password” field.
8. Click on the “Apply” button to save your changes.
Your Comcast Business Router is now set up and ready to use!

What are some tips for using a Comcast Business Router
If you’re a small business owner, there’s a good chance you’re using a Comcast Business Router. Here are some tips to help you get the most out of your router:
1. Keep your firmware up to date. Like any piece of software, the firmware that powers your router can occasionally need an update. Fortunately, Comcast makes it easy to check for and install updates right from the web interface.
2. Take advantage of Quality of Service (QoS). If you often find yourself working with bandwidth-intensive applications like video conferencing or VoIP, QoS can be a lifesaver. It allows you to prioritize traffic so that time-sensitive data gets through even when the network is congested.
3. Make use of port forwarding. Need to set up remote access to your network? Port forwarding can make it possible by opening up a specific port on the router and directing traffic to the internal IP address of the computer or server you want to access.
4. Use a VPN for extra security. A Virtual Private Network (VPN) encrypts all the data that passes between your network and the VPN server, making it much more difficult for anyone to snoop on your traffic. If you frequently work with sensitive data, a VPN is a must.
5. Get familiar with the firewall features. The firewall built into your Comcast Business Router can help protect your network from attacks, but it’s important to understand how it works before you enable it. Otherwise, you may accidentally block legitimate traffic.
By following these tips, you can get more out of your Comcast Business Router and keep your small business network running smoothly.
